Ticket VX-4417, for discussion at the weekly eng sync. The Splitlark experiment assignment service cannot start because its config vault sealed itself after three failed unseal attempts during Tuesday's node replacement. Assignment reads are currently served from the last-known snapshot, so bucket drift is possible for experiments modified after 09:00. Marisol has verified the snapshot checksum and prepared the unseal runbook. Per policy, the vault accepts a manual recovery passphrase, recorded below for the sync facilitator.

unlock words, tagag-taduf: praath-druiel-casix-sildor-julax-ralvan-holix

Subject: Key rotation for snapshot test service

Heads up for this week's sync: the credential for Framecast, our snapshot-testing service for UI components, was rotated yesterday as part of the quarterly schedule. CI jobs on the Petalwick repo will fail baseline uploads until the new key is in place. Local runs are unaffected since they skip the upload step. Update your pipeline config with the new key, shown here.

API key for fahip-kahip: zpat23_XiJGUHz5xfaAtaIqUkus0rh

Migration step 4 of 7 — Gatewright rate limiting. Before routing traffic through the new Gatewright tier, confirm the legacy limiter on Old Harrow is set to shadow mode, otherwise clients will be double-counted and throttled early. Watch the rejection-rate panel for ten minutes after the switch; anything above 0.5% means the token buckets are undersized. Once shadow mode is verified, load the limiter with the values shown below.

settings of tagef-bawif:
DRUIX_HOST=druix.zemvarlabs.internal
DRUIX_PORT=8000

Meeting notes — Retention sweeper review

The Tidewell sweeper skipped two partitions last run due to a lock timeout; affected rows will be purged on the next cycle. On-call should watch the sweep-duration dashboard tonight and page only if it exceeds four hours. Escalation contact for sweeper failures is noted below.

signatory, fafog-bagef: Jorwyn Juleth Pelius